Citizens and residents of the European Union have the right to access documents from the European Parliament, the Council and the European Commission (Article 15 of the Treaty on the Functioning of the EU)

In order to facilitate access to documents, an online register has been put in place with reference to Commission documents produced since January 2001 (legislative documents, agendas and minutes of Commission meetings)

To request a copy of an internal (unpublished) document or a document that does not appear in the register, please fill in the document request form.

The scope of the Access to Documents Regulation, limitations, and deadlines for handling requests are all detailed in the guide for citizens.
